The Jallianwala Bagh National Memorial Act, 1951

The Jallianwala Bagh National Memorial Act, 1951 is an Indian law that provides for the construction and management of a national memorial at the site of the Jallianwala Bagh massacre in Amritsar.

Summary

The Jallianwala Bagh National Memorial Act, 1951 was enacted to establish a national memorial at the site of the Jallianwala Bagh massacre in Amritsar, Punjab. The Act provides for the establishment of a trust to manage the memorial and outlines the composition, powers and functions of the trust. It also lays down the guidelines for the management and maintenance of the memorial, including provisions for the appointment of a custodian, the construction of a suitable building, and the display of information and exhibits related to the massacre. The Act also provides for the funding of the trust and outlines the various sources of revenue for the maintenance of the memorial.
